About This Reader

This educational content features a fascinating reading passage, audio integrated for an enhanced learning experience, about the aorta. Students will discover how this vital organ, the body's largest artery, carries oxygen-rich blood from the heart to the rest of the body. The passage defines key terms like 'artery' and 'elasticity,' explaining the aorta's unique structure that allows it to withstand high blood pressure. Activities include multiple-choice questions, a glossary, and short answer questions, all designed to reinforce understanding of NGSS standard LS1.A: Structure and Function. This resource is perfect for grade 6 students learning about the human circulatory system, offering insights into how the aorta's form directly supports its essential function.
